Advocates, experts recommend reforms to inadequate Kansas payday loan system
TOPEKA — a customers finance expert is recommending Kansas generate cash advance reforms that may conserve buyers significantly more than 25 million every year while still sustaining credit accessibility.
These financing attended under flames in claims around the world, with heading so far as to exclude all of them. Facts shows that although the almost all those acceng these loans tend to be white, African-Americans is disproportionately influenced.
TiJuana Hardwell, a residential area coordinator in Wichita, discussed Thursday her personal experience using the predatory nature of existing loan design making use of the Kansas Commion on Racial Equity and fairness Subcommittee on business economics. She recalled that the girl mother became caught in a cycle of financial loans and monthly payments to compliment Hardwell along with her six siblings after a divorce.
Each payday, after cashing the lady see from perform, the lady mother would push to pay right back the mortgage then immediately take out another mortgage to make sure they’d adequate revenue to call home on. Sometimes, she would even get loans from two lenders at any given time.

An instant payday loan in Kansas of 300 will frequently incur about 450 in charges for a maximum of 750, in accordance with Pew charity Trusts. Lasting loans have cultivated in recognition in Kansas but there is however no limit on which lenders may charge.
Gabe Kravitz, a consumer finance professional for Pew Charitable Trusts, mentioned lines of credit for smaller amounts is helpful if structured effectively, in Kansas, mainstream payday advances carry out more damage than great. The guy mentioned the two-week debts a lot of loan providers offering usually simply take a 3rd of the debtor next salary and then leave all of them in debt for typically five several months.
The payday loans places in Kansas nowadays are approximately 3 x greater than in states having updated their statutes and highly secure buyers,Kravitz mentioned. Theyve accomplished that by calling for inexpensive installment financing tissues by bringing down the prices and making sure there are not any unintended has of condition statute or loopholes inside the laws.”
Kravitz advised Kansas stick to the course taken by Colorado. Around, lawmakers and stakeholders hit a center soil by properly prohibiting the two-week installment and replacing them with a six-month installment mortgage featuring affordable payments.
Colorado saw mortgage costs drop by 42per cent. Kansas and Virginia have actually since adopted a comparable route, and payment outlay have actually decreased to 4percent for the loanee next paycheck.
